'Mistresses' to return for second series

The channel has ordered six new episodes of the drama, about a group of thirty-something women looking for romance.
Stars Sarah Parish, Sharon Small, Orla Brady and Shelley Conn will all return to filming in September.
Julie Gardner, the BBC's head of drama in Wales, said: "The first series really struck a chord with the BBC audience and we're thrilled to be welcoming the characters back so we can further enjoy the thrills and spills of their messy, romantic lives."
Douglas Rae, executive producer of the show at Ecosse Films, said it had received a "phenomenal" response to Mistresses.
"In the new series we will learn a great deal more about Katie, Trudi, Siobhan and Jessica as well as the men, and women, in their lives," he said. "We are planning plenty more surprises and maybe even a couple of new faces will be joining the cast – watch this space!"
This year's run attracted an average audience of 5.2m on BBC One at 9pm on Tuesdays.
